Algorithmic Attribution
Algorithmic Attribution is a data-driven approach that uses statistical or machine learning models to assign conversion credit based on each touchpoint's measured contribution rather than a fixed rule.
Also known as: data-driven attribution, model-based attribution, machine learning attribution
Algorithmic Attribution, also called data-driven attribution, replaces fixed crediting rules with a statistical or machine learning model that learns how much each touchpoint actually contributes to a conversion. Rather than imposing weights like first-touch or 40-40-20, the model derives them from observed patterns in the underlying data.
What Algorithmic Attribution Means
Algorithmic Attribution is a class of measurement models that derive touchpoint weights from the data itself rather than from analyst convention. The most common implementations use logistic regression, Markov chains, or Shapley value decomposition to compare the touchpoint paths of converters and non-converters. The output is a weighting scheme that adapts as buyer behavior shifts, which is why ad platforms now default to data-driven models when conversion volume allows. It is the most rigorous form of touch-based attribution available, though it remains correlational rather than causal in nature.
How Algorithmic Attribution Works
The model estimates the marginal lift each channel contributes by examining how often it appears in converting paths versus non-converting ones, then assigns credit proportional to that incremental contribution. Stable models typically need thousands of conversions across a wide spread of paths, which most B2B environments cannot produce. The output is also harder to defend in a CFO review than a simple rule, so teams often blend algorithmic methods with simpler models on lower-volume events or supplement them with incrementality experiments. Match rate quality, data freshness, and retrain cadence determine whether the model stays calibrated.
Common Pitfalls and Misconceptions
The biggest misconception is that algorithmic models prove causation. They identify correlation between touchpoints and outcomes more rigorously than rule-based models, but only controlled experiments such as holdout or incrementality tests can establish causal impact. The second pitfall is data volume: most B2B teams running algorithmic attribution on under 1,000 monthly conversions are looking at noise dressed up as math. The third is opacity, which makes the output harder to defend when a CFO or sales leader challenges a specific channel’s credit allocation and the team cannot explain why the model assigned it.
Algorithmic Attribution in Practice
The practitioner move is triangulation. Use Algorithmic Attribution on high-volume top-of-funnel events, layer a rule-based model like W-shaped on lower-volume pipeline and revenue events, and validate both with periodic geo-holdout or matched-market tests. The algorithm catches correlations humans miss; the experiments catch the correlations the algorithm mistakes for cause. Retrain at least quarterly, more often if you change channels, audiences, or pricing. Treating any single number as truth is the fastest way to misallocate budget, and the cleanest measurement programs explicitly report results from two or three models alongside each other so the disagreement itself becomes the diagnostic.
